Town Municipal Corporation Manghopir Department of Information & Public RelationsPress ReleaseDate: Monday, 17th September 2025

Chairman of Manghopir Town, Haji Nawaz Ali Brohi, paid a detailed visit today to Allah Bachayo Goth, Union Committee No. 2, where he inspected the ongoing development work of paver block installation. On this occasion, Chairman Haji Nawaz Ali Brohi closely reviewed the work being carried out on various streets and roads and directed the staff that there should be no compromise on construction quality and pace. He emphasized that all development projects are being carried out with the intention of serving the public and providing them with facilities, and any negligence or carelessness will not be tolerated.

Chairman Manghopir Town, Haji Nawaz Ali Brohi, stated that the issues of Allah Bachayo Goth UC No. 2, as well as the entire town, are his top priority. He said that under a comprehensive planning strategy, work is underway to address the long-standing shortage of infrastructure in the area. The installation of paver blocks will provide long-term convenience to the local population. The improvement of streets and roads will make commuting easier, enhance drainage during rains, and rid the people of problems related to mud and unhygienic conditions.

Haji Nawaz Ali Brohi further said that Allah Bachayo Goth UC No. 2 is an old and important locality where the population was in dire need of basic facilities. With the installation of paver blocks, residents will not only get better facilities but local economy and business activities will also improve. He added that no area of Manghopir Town will be neglected, and all projects will be completed on a priority basis.

On this occasion, District West Information Secretary Ali Akbar Kachhelo, Younus Mengal, Shakoor Mengal, and Azam Mengal were also present alongside the Chairman. A large number of local residents and dignitaries participated in the inspection visit and paid tribute to the efforts of the Chairman Manghopir Town. The public said that in the past, the area had been neglected, but the present Chairman has restored public confidence through practical steps.

Chairman Haji Nawaz Ali Brohi thanked the people and said that his sole purpose is public service. He stated that the residents of Manghopir Town have always trusted him, and he is striving day and night to live up to that trust. He further announced that more development projects will soon be launched, including the further construction of roads, improvement of the sewerage system, strengthening of cleanliness services, and upgradation of the street lighting system.
